Re: What is the difference between the Forza, NSS300 & NSS30
Forza is a series name, there have been 250 Forzas, the 300 Forza and the most recent addition, the 125 Forza.
The 125,250 and 300 are all entirely different, all they share is the Forza series name.
In the USA there has only ever been one version marketed under the Forza name, the NSS300.
The NSS300 fitted with ABS is the NSS300A (A=ABS)
There are variations of features between different markets, but there is only one Forza 300 available in the USA, with or without ABS.
There have been no changes in any model year.

Wonder what is different with the 'G' model - NSS300G

Re: What is the difference between the Forza, NSS300 & NSS30
Nothing.iceman wrote:Wonder what is different with the 'G' model - NSS300G
G means 2016
A NSS300G is a non ABS 2016 NSS 300 Forza.
A 2016 ABS Forza would be a NSS300AG
